Why FIFA Remains the Go‑To Soccer Game
If you’ve ever asked yourself which soccer video game tops the list, the answer usually points to FIFA. It offers realistic graphics, deep rosters, and game modes that let you build a career, manage a team, or just have a quick kick‑about. Readers love the Career mode’s depth, while the Ultimate Team mode keeps the excitement alive with weekly challenges and fresh packs.
One of our recent posts breaks down the pros and cons of FIFA versus its rivals. While PES (now called eFootball) nails tactical nuance, FIFA wins on accessibility and the sheer number of licensed leagues. That balance makes it the perfect pick for both casual fans and hardcore strategists.

How do you make a video game like FIFA?
Making a video game like FIFA involves a complex process that includes creating realistic graphics, designing gameplay mechanics, and ensuring smooth controls. First, a team of developers must work on the game engine, which powers the graphics and physics. Next, artists and animators create the visual assets, while programmers develop the gameplay and controls. Additionally, the game needs to be thoroughly tested for bugs and glitches. Finally, marketing and promotion efforts take place to ensure the game's success upon release.
